I think the best thing you can do is be completely open and honest with the Pdoc about your feelings and experiences and let them be the one to diagnose you. If you are BP your doc will be able to diagnose you based on hearing you talk about what you've been experiencing. I'd mention your previous experience with the VA doc, I think that's good information for the new doc to have. But I'd just go in with an open mind, the doc will know what questions to ask to get the most accurate diagnosis. Good luck.
